Two numbers are such that if 7 is added to the smaller number then their sum becomes double of the larger number and if 4 is added to the larger number then their sum becomes three times the smaller number. Find both the numbers.

Let the larger number be x and smaller be y


When 7 is added to the smaller number their sum becomes double of the larger number


y + 7 = 2x


y = 2x - 7 …equation (i)


When 4 is added to the larger number their sum becomes three times of the smaller number


x + 4 = 3y


x = 3y - 4 ……equation(ii)


Putting the value of y in equation (ii) we get


x = 3(2x - 7) - 4


x = 6x - 21 - 4


5x = 25


x = 5


y = 2x – 7


Now putting the value of x in this equation


Y = 2 x 5 – 7


y = 3


Answer: The numbers are 5 and 3
